- Error reading infotype 2001 ?The SAP error message 5N289, which states "Error reading infotype 2001," typically occurs when there is an issue with accessing or retrieving data from the infotype 2001 (which is related to "Absences") in the SAP Human Capital Management (HCM) module. Here are some common causes, potential solutions, and related information for this error:
Causes:
- Data Inconsistency: There may be inconsistencies or missing data in the infotype 2001 records.
- Authorization Issues: The user may not have the necessary authorizations to access the infotype data.
- Technical Issues: There could be a technical issue with the database or the SAP system itself.
- Incorrect Configuration: The configuration settings for the infotype may not be set up correctly.
- Missing Entries: The employee for whom the data is being accessed may not have any entries in infotype 2001.
Solutions:
Check Data Consistency:
- Use transaction codes like SE16 or SE11 to check the entries in the infotype 2001 table (PA2001).
- Look for any missing or inconsistent records.
Review Authorizations:
- Ensure that the user has the necessary authorizations to access infotype 2001. This can be checked in transaction PFCG or SU53.
Check Configuration:
- Review the configuration settings for infotype 2001 in the IMG (Implementation Guide) under the HCM module to ensure everything is set up correctly.
Debugging:
- If you have access to debugging tools, you can use transaction SE80 or SE37 to debug the program or function module that is trying to read the infotype.
Check for Missing Entries:
- Verify if the employee has any records in infotype 2001. If not, you may need to create the necessary entries.
Consult SAP Notes:
- Check the SAP Support Portal for any relevant SAP Notes that may address this specific error message.
System Logs:
- Review system logs (transaction SM21) for any additional error messages or warnings that could provide more context about the issue.
